What is Adaptive AI ?
Summary
TLDRAdaptive AI is revolutionizing technology by embracing constant change and learning in real time. Unlike traditional AI, which operates on fixed datasets, adaptive AI evolves continuously, adapting to new challenges and environments. It learns from data, refines its algorithms, and improves performance over time. With applications across industries like healthcare, finance, and automotive, adaptive AI enhances decision-making and efficiency. Though it offers significant benefits, including high performance and reduced human intervention, it also presents challenges related to resource demands, ethical concerns, and data privacy. The future of adaptive AI promises transformative potential, reshaping industries and solving critical global issues.

Q & A
What is adaptive AI and how does it differ from traditional AI?
-Adaptive AI is a dynamic form of artificial intelligence that continuously evolves by learning from new data and adapting to changing environments. Unlike traditional AI, which is static and learns from a fixed dataset, adaptive AI thrives on real-time learning, making it more responsive and effective in complex, dynamic situations.
Why is adaptive AI seen as a significant leap forward in technology?
-Adaptive AI represents a leap forward because it is fluid, adaptable, and capable of evolving in real-time. It not only processes vast amounts of data but also learns from it, understanding patterns, making informed decisions, and improving continuously without requiring manual retraining.
What are the three key features that set adaptive AI apart?
-The three key features of adaptive AI are: 1) Continuous learning, as it gathers and processes new data over time; 2) Real-time adaptation, where it adjusts to new situations without needing retraining; 3) Self-improvement, where it actively seeks ways to enhance its own performance, becoming more efficient and effective over time.
How does adaptive AI learn and improve its performance?
-Adaptive AI learns through a feedback loop where it takes in data, makes decisions, observes the outcomes, and adjusts its approach based on this feedback. This continuous cycle allows it to refine its algorithms and improve its accuracy, similar to a child learning a new skill like riding a bike.
How does adaptive AI handle new, unforeseen situations compared to traditional AI?
-Traditional AI struggles with new situations since it relies on a fixed dataset and predefined algorithms. In contrast, adaptive AI thrives on uncertainty by adapting its behavior in real-time, using feedback to improve its responses and making it more capable of handling unpredictable challenges.
What are some real-world applications of adaptive AI?
-Adaptive AI is already making an impact in various industries. In healthcare, it personalizes treatment plans and adjusts medication dosages. In finance, it detects fraud by analyzing transaction patterns. In the automotive industry, adaptive AI powers self-driving cars, helping them navigate complex environments and react to unexpected situations.
What benefits does adaptive AI offer compared to traditional AI?
-Adaptive AI offers numerous benefits, including real-time problem-solving, reduced need for human intervention, and high performance in complex and dynamic settings. It also continuously improves its performance, making it more efficient and effective over time.
What challenges does adaptive AI face in its development and deployment?
-Despite its advantages, adaptive AI faces challenges such as requiring significant computational resources and raising ethical concerns around data privacy and algorithmic bias. Addressing these issues is crucial for the responsible development and deployment of adaptive AI.
How does the concept of adaptive AI compare to a human learning process?
-Adaptive AI mimics the human learning process, similar to how a child learns to ride a bike. Initially, it may struggle or make mistakes, but over time it learns from feedback, adjusts its actions, and improves its performance continuously.
What is the future potential of adaptive AI?
-The future of adaptive AI is bright, with the potential to revolutionize various industries. As technology advances, adaptive AI will enable more innovative applications, helping solve complex global problems and transforming industries, reshaping how we live and interact with technology.
